EVERY NEW CLIENT WALKS

Because walking is where your body tells the truth.

Walking is something you do thousands of times every day without thinking, yet it is one of the quickest ways to understand how your body is really functioning.

Every step requires your feet, pelvis, spine, ribcage and head to work together. When one area loses movement, another area often adapts to compensate. These adaptations may have been developing for years before pain ever appeared.

That's why every new client walks.

Not as a test to pass or fail, but because walking often reveals movement patterns that simply can't be seen while lying on a treatment table.

Understanding how you move gives us a clearer picture of why your symptoms developed in the first place and helps us build a treatment plan that addresses the whole body rather than chasing individual symptoms.
